Good to know
Seating, Parking & Venue Information
- Park size is about 502 hectares; the broader area including Todai-ji, Kofuku-ji, Kasuga Shrine, and related facilities can be around 660 hectares in total.
- Address areas include Zoshicho, Takabatake-cho, Kasugano-cho, and Noborioji-cho in Nara City.
- Not a single venue with a seating chart; indoor event space exists at the Nara Park Bus Terminal Lecture Hall with capacity 300.
- Parking in the park area relies on nearby city lots (e.g., Noboriōji, Daibutsumae, Takabatake); the park itself does not have a dedicated on-site parking lot.
- Transit access: about a 5–10 minute walk from Kintetsu Nara Station; JR Nara Station is served by Gurutto Bus routes including Nara Park and Omiya routes.
- Nearby hotels serving park visitors include Nara Hotel, Kotonoyado Musashino, MIROKU NARA by THE SHARE HOTELS, and Noborioji Hotel.
- Notable events and activities associated with Nara Park include deer-related practices (e.g., deer interactions and antler-related activities) and local festivals such as Basara Festival.
